网站采集技巧

网站采集技巧

在信息爆炸的时代,获取准确、有用的数据对于个人和企业来说至关重要。而网站采集技巧是其中的关键一环。本文将分享一些有效的网站采集技巧,帮助您更高效地进行网络数据采集。

一、了解目标网站

在进行网站采集之前,首先需要详细了解目标网站的结构、数据格式及相关规则。可以通过查看网站源代码、审查元素等方式来获取这些信息。了解目标网站的结构有助于设计有效的采集策略。

二、选择合适的采集工具

网站采集可以借助专业的采集工具来完成,比如Python中的Scrapy、BeautifulSoup等工具。这些工具提供了强大的功能和灵活的配置选项,能够满足各种不同的采集需求。

三、设置合理的采集频率

在进行网站采集时,需要设置合理的采集频率,以避免对目标网站造成过大的访问压力。过高的访问频率可能会导致目标网站无法正常访问或屏蔽您的IP地址。因此,根据目标网站的规则和限制,合理设置采集频率非常重要。

四、使用代理IP

为了避免被目标网站封禁,您可以使用代理IP进行采集。使用代理IP可以隐藏您的真实IP地址,降低被封禁的风险。可以通过购买代理IP服务,或者使用一些免费的代理IP池来获取可用的代理IP地址。

五、处理反爬虫机制

许多网站会采取反爬虫机制,以防止非法的数据采集。为了绕过这些机制,您可以使用一些技巧,比如设置合理的请求头信息、模拟用户操作、使用验证码识别工具等。同时,也要注意尊重网站的规则,合法、合规地进行数据采集。

六、数据存储与处理

采集到的数据需要进行存储和处理,以便后续的分析和应用。可以将数据保存为文本文件、数据库或者其他格式,根据需求灵活选择适合的存储方式。此外,还可以使用数据清洗和预处理技术,提高数据质量和分析效果。

七、监控与维护

进行网站采集的过程中,需要时刻监控采集任务的状态,并进行必要的维护和调整。可以设置定时任务来定期运行采集程序,及时发现和处理异常情况。同时,也要关注目标网站的变化,及时调整采集策略。

总结:网站采集技巧是从庞杂的网络中快速获取有效数据的关键一步。通过了解目标网站、选择合适的采集工具、设置合理的采集频率、使用代理IP、处理反爬虫机制、合理存储和处理数据,以及进行监控与维护,可以帮助您更高效、稳定地进行网站采集。希望本文的分享对您的网站采集工作有所帮助。

转载请说明出处内容投诉
147SEO » 网站采集技巧

发表评论

欢迎 访客 发表评论

一个令你着迷的主题!

查看演示 官网购买
×

服务热线

微信客服

微信客服